The Philadelphia-Camden-Wilmington Metropolitan Statistical Area is the 7th largest metro in the United States, spanning ten counties across four states. With a GDP of $557.6 billion and the 6th densest city population in the country, Philadelphia offers unparalleled concentration of households for door hanger distribution:
Population: 1,550,542 • 6th densest major city at 11,379/sq mi • Median home value: $265,000 • Median household income: $61,953 • Iconic neighborhoods from Center City to Chestnut Hill

Get Your Free Quote NowPhiladelphia’s Hispanic and Latino population has grown 27% in the past decade, now representing 15.6% of the city’s population — approximately 246,000 residents. The largest groups include Puerto Ricans (the largest Latino community), followed by growing Dominican, Venezuelan, Colombian, Honduran, and Salvadoran populations. Beyond Spanish, Philadelphia is home to significant Chinese (Mandarin/Cantonese), Russian, Arabic, and Vietnamese-speaking communities.
This linguistic diversity is not limited to the city itself. Hispanic communities thrive throughout the suburban counties, particularly in Norristown (Montgomery County), Kennett Square (Chester County, home to one of the state’s largest Mexican communities), Camden and Burlington Counties in New Jersey, and Wilmington, Delaware.
With 27% growth per decade and increasingly strong purchasing power, Hispanic households represent one of the highest-growth target audiences in the Philadelphia metro.
